Star Rating
Hotel Name
Price Range (USD) to
Amenities
+ More

33736 Hotels/Motels & Accommodations

Blind Pass Resort Motel
+1-888-389-4121
7901 Blind Pass Rd., St Pete Beach, FL 33706 ~0.37 miles northwest of 33736
  • Inexpensive Beach property
  • Hotel has 25 rooms
From$60
Very Good 4.0 /5 Read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in 33736" Get Alexa Skill →
Postcard Inn on the Beach
+1-888-675-2083
6300 Gulf Blvd., St Pete Beach, FL 33706 ~0.61 miles south of 33736
  • Three Star Beach hotel
  • Fitness center on property
From$85
Average 3.0 /5 Reviews Call BookMore Details
Hilton Garden Inn St. Pete Beach : 6100 Gulf Blvd.
+1-800-716-8490
6100 Gulf Blvd., St. Pete Beach, FL 33706 ~0.69 miles south of 33736
  • Three Star Beach hotel
  • Hotel has 5 floors
From$169
Average 3.0 /5 Reviews Call BookMore Details
RumFish Beach Resort by TradeWinds in St. Pete Beach
+1-800-805-5223
6000 Gulf Blvd., St. Pete Beach, FL 33706 ~0.72 miles south of 33736
  • Four star hotel
  • 130 suites in hotel
From$160
Very Good 4.0 /5 Read Reviews Call BookMore Details
Alden Suites - A Beachfront Resort - St. Pete Beach
+1-888-965-1860
5900 Gulf Blvd., St. Pete Beach, FL 33706 ~0.73 miles south of 33736
  • Midscale Beach property
  • 6 floors in property
From$88
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Island Grand a Tradewinds Beach Resort
+1-888-788-5576
5500 Gulf Blvd., St Pete Beach, FL 33706 ~0.93 miles south of 33736
  • 4-star Beach property
  • Check-in time: 11.00 am
From$125
Very Good 4.0 /5 Review Score Call BookMore Details
Sirata Beach Resort - St. Pete Beach
+1-888-897-9207
5300 Gulf Blvd., St. Pete Beach, FL 33706 ~1.11 miles south of 33736
  • 3-star Beach property
  • Hotel has an eco-friendly policy Read more
From$89
Average 3.0 /5 Reviews Call BookMore Details
Beachcomber Beach Resort
+1-888-311-4278
6200 Gulf Blvd., St. Pete Beach, FL 33706 ~1.20 miles south of 33736
  • 3 star Oceanfront property
  • 12 floors in property
From$80
Average 3.0 /5 Review Score Call BookMore Details
Bellwether Beach Resort in St. Pete Beach
+1-888-469-4795
5250 Gulf Blvd., St. Pete Beach, FL 33706 ~1.20 miles south of 33736
  • Affordable Oceanfront hotel
  • Fitness + Health Center
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Dolphin Beach Resort : 4900 Gulf Blvd.
+1-888-734-9421
4900 Gulf Blvd., St. Pete Beach, FL 33706 ~1.45 miles south of 33736
  • High-end Beach hotel
  • 5 conference rooms in property
From$125
Average 3.0 /5 Guest Reviews Call BookMore Details
Plaza Beach Hotel Beachfront Resort
+1-888-841-5292
4506 Gulf Blvd., St Pete Beach, FL 33706 ~1.63 miles south of 33736
  • Three Star Beach property
  • 39 suites in property
From$89
Very Good 4.0 /5 Reviews Call BookMore Details
Provident Oceana Beachfront - Treasure Island
+1-888-455-5160
10091 Bulf Blvd., Treasure Island, FL 33706 ~1.68 miles northwest of 33736
  • Midscale property
  • Check in time: 16:00
From$90
Excellent 5.0 /5 Reviews Call BookMore Details
Two Mermaids Resort - Treasure Island
+1-888-965-8297
10200 Gulf Blvd., Treasure Island, FL 33706 ~1.82 miles northwest of 33736
  • Three Star hotel
  • Check in time: 16:00
From$90
Average 3.0 /5 Review Score Call BookMore Details
Westwinds Waterfront Resort
+1-888-906-6358
10265 Gulf Blvd., Treasure Island, FL 33706 ~1.89 miles northwest of 33736
  • Three Star Beach hotel
  • Check in time: 3:00 pm
From$80
Very Good 4.0 /5 Read Reviews Call BookMore Details
Lorelei Resort Motel
+1-888-749-6785
10273 Gulf Blvd., Treasure Island, FL 33706 ~1.89 miles northwest of 33736
  • Inexpensive hotel
From$60
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in 33736" Get Alexa Skill →
Crystal Bay Hotel in St. Petersburg
+1-888-878-9982
7401 Central Ave., St. Petersburg, FL 33710 ~2.04 miles north of 33736
  • Inexpensive Suburban hotel
  • Has environment-friendly policy Learn more
From$60
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Beach House Suites by The Don Cesar in St Pete Beach
+1-888-389-4485
3860 Gulf Blvd., St Pete Beach, FL 33706 ~2.04 miles south of 33736
  • Affordable Beach hotel
  • Gym is available on property
From$159
Very Good 4.0 /5 Guest Reviews Call BookMore Details
The Hotel Zamora : 3701 Gulf Blvd.
+1-888-389-4121
3701 Gulf Blvd., St Pete Beach, FL 33706 ~2.12 miles south of 33736
  • High end Beach property
  • 36 suites in property
From$129
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Fusion Resort : 290 107th Ave.
+1-888-675-2083
290 107th Ave., Treasure Island, FL 33706 ~2.22 miles northwest of 33736
  • 3 star Beach hotel
  • 42 suites in hotel
From$120
Average 3.0 /5 Recent Reviews Call BookMore Details
Bilmar Beach Resort
+1-800-716-8490
10650 Gulf Blvd., Treasure Island, FL 33706 ~2.23 miles northwest of 33736
  • Three Star Beach property
  • 5 conference rooms in property
From$99
Very Good 4.0 /5 Review Score Call BookMore Details
The Don Cesar - St. Pete Beach
+1-800-805-5223
3400 Gulf Blvd., St. Pete Beach, FL 33706 ~2.39 miles south of 33736
  • Four-star Resort hotel
  • Check-in time: 4pm
From$189
Very Good 4.0 /5 Recent Reviews Call BookMore Details
Treasure Bay Resort & Marina in Treasure Island
+1-888-965-1860
11125 Gulf Blvd., Treasure Island, FL 33706 ~2.46 miles northwest of 33736
  • Mid-scale Beach hotel
  • Check-in: 03:00 pm
From$79
Very Good 4.0 /5 Guest Reviews Call BookMore Details
The Bayside Inn & Marina in Treasure Island
+1-888-788-5576
11365 Gulf Blvd., Treasure Island, FL 33706 ~2.62 miles northwest of 33736
  • 2 star Beach hotel
  • Check-in: 3:00 pm
From$47
Average 3.0 /5 Read Reviews Call BookMore Details
Treasure Island Ocean Club - Treasure Island
+1-888-897-9207
11500 Gulf Blvd., Treasure Island, FL 33706 ~2.68 miles northwest of 33736
  • Two-star Beach property
  • 54 rooms in property
From$69
Average 3.5 /5 Review Score Call BookMore Details
Crystal Palms Beach Resort
+1-888-311-4278
11605 Gulf Blvd., Treasure Island, FL 33706 ~2.74 miles northwest of 33736
  • Midscale Beach hotel
  • 6 floors in hotel
From$140
Very Good 4.5 /5 Hotel Reviews Call BookMore Details
Residence Inn St Petersburg Treasure Island : 11908 Gulf Blvd.
+1-888-469-4795
11908 Gulf Blvd., Treasure Island, FL 33706 ~2.94 miles northwest of 33736
  • Three Star Oceanfront hotel
  • 105 rooms in property
From$219
Poor 2.0 /5 Reviews Call BookMore Details
Sunset Vistas Two Bedroom Beachfront Suites : 12000 Gulf Blvd.
+1-888-734-9421
12000 Gulf Blvd., Treasure Island, FL 33706 ~3.00 miles northwest of 33736
  • Mid-scale Beach hotel
  • Airport shuttle provided
From$139
Very Good 4.0 /5 Guest Reviews Call BookMore Details
John's Pass Hotel
+1-888-841-5292
111 Boardwalk Pl East, Madeira Beach, FL 33708 ~3.61 miles northwest of 33736
  • Two star Beach hotel
  • 14 rooms in property
From$60
Average 3.0 /5 Reviews Call BookMore Details
All Season's Resort in Madeira Beach
+1-888-455-5160
13070 Gulf Blvd., Madeira Beach, FL 33708 ~3.83 miles northwest of 33736
  • Affordable property
  • Check-in: 4:00 PM
From$107
Average 3.0 /5 Review Score Call BookMore Details
Madeira Bay Resort II by Travel Resort Services in Madeira Beach
+1-888-965-8297
13235 Gulf Blvd., Madeira Beach, FL 33708 ~3.94 miles northwest of 33736
  • Mid-scale Beach hotel
  • 68 suites in hotel
From$130
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Barefoot Beach Club
+1-888-906-6358
13238 Gulf Blvd., Madeira Beach, FL 33708 ~3.96 miles northwest of 33736
  • Mid-scale Beach property
  • Check-in time: 3:00 PM
From$109
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Residence Inn Marriott St. Petersburg Tierra Verde - Tierra Verde
+1-888-749-6785
214 Madonna Blvd., Tierra Verde, FL 33715 ~3.98 miles south of 33736
  • Three Star Beach property
  • Check in: 4:00PM
From$90
Average 3.0 /5 Review Score Call BookMore Details
Days Inn by Wyndham St. Petersburg Central
+1-888-878-9982
650 34th St. North, St. Petersburg, FL 33713 ~4.86 miles northeast of 33736
  • Economical property
  • Hotel has 2 floors
From$60
Average 3.5 /5 Recent Reviews Call BookMore Details
Holiday Isles Resort - Madeira Beach
+1-888-389-4485
14711 Gulf Blvd., Madeira Beach, FL 33708 ~4.99 miles northwest of 33736
  • Low Cost Beach property
  • Check in: 2:00 PM
From$50
Average 3.0 /5 Recent Reviews Call BookMore Details
Sky Beach Resort & Marina in St. Petersburg
+1-888-389-4121
6800 Sunshine Skyway Ln South, St. Petersburg, FL 33711 ~5.02 miles southeast of 33736
  • Three Star Beach hotel
  • Check in time: 3pm
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Holiday Inn St. Petersburg West : 1200 34th St. North
+1-888-675-2083
1200 34th St. North, St. Petersburg, FL 33713 ~5.02 miles northeast of 33736
  • 3 star Highway property
  • 3 meeting rooms in hotel
From$80
Average 3.0 /5 Read Reviews Call BookMore Details
Quality Inn & Suites at Tropicana Field : 1400 34th St. North
+1-800-716-8490
1400 34th St. North, St.petersburg, FL 33713 ~5.13 miles northeast of 33736
  • Two-star hotel
  • Hotel has 3 floors
From$60
Very Good 4.0 /5 Reviews Call BookMore Details
Cambria Hotel St. Petersburg Madeira Beach
+1-800-805-5223
15015 Madeira Way, Madeira Beach, FL 33708 ~5.24 miles northwest of 33736
  • High-end Resort hotel
  • 125 rooms in hotel
From$159
Excellent 5.0 /5 Read Reviews Call BookMore Details
Holiday Inn Express & Suites St. Petersburg Madeira Beach - St. Petersburg
+1-888-965-1860
4816 100th Way North, St. Petersburg, FL 33708 ~5.39 miles north of 33736
  • 3-star Suburban hotel
  • 5 floors in property
From$98
Very Good 4.0 /5 Review Score Call BookMore Details
Courtyard by Marriott St. Petersburg Clearwater / Madeira Beach in Madeira Beach
+1-888-788-5576
601 American Legion Dr., Madeira Beach, FL 33708 ~5.45 miles northwest of 33736
  • Midscale Beach hotel
  • Check in time: 11:00 AM
From$119
Very Good 4.0 /5 Review Score Call BookMore Details
TRU by Hilton St. Petersburg Downtown Central Avenue - St. Petersburg
+1-888-897-9207
1650 Central Ave., St. Petersburg, FL 33712 ~5.97 miles east of 33736
  • Affordable Downtown hotel
  • Check in: 3:00PM
From$80
Very Good 4.0 /5 Review Score Call BookMore Details
Staybridge Suites St. Petersburg Downtown
+1-888-311-4278
940 5th Ave. South, St. Petersburg, FL 33705 ~6.34 miles east of 33736
  • Mid-scale Downtown hotel
  • Hotel has 119 rooms
From$89
Very Good 4.0 /5 Review Score Call BookMore Details
Mint House St. Petersburg Downtown : 77 11th St. North
+1-888-469-4795
77 11th St. North, St. Petersburg, FL 33705 ~6.36 miles east of 33736
  • High-end Downtown hotel
  • Check-in: 3:00PM
From$125
Average 3.0 /5 Read Reviews Call BookMore Details
Red Roof Inn Tampa Bay - St Petersburg - St Petersburg
+1-888-734-9421
4999 34th St. North, St Petersburg, FL 33714 ~6.67 miles northeast of 33736
  • Low Cost Suburban hotel
  • Access to gym on-site
From$44
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Super 8 by Wyndham St. Petersburg - St. Petersburg
+1-888-841-5292
5005a 34th St. North, St. Petersburg, FL 33714 ~6.72 miles northeast of 33736
  • Two-star Downtown hotel
  • Free breakfast available
From$60
Average 3.0 /5 Review Score Call BookMore Details
Days Inn by Wyndham St. Petersburg / Tampa Bay Area in St. Petersburg
+1-888-455-5160
5005 34th St. North, St. Petersburg, FL 33714 ~6.72 miles northeast of 33736
  • Mid-scale Suburban property
  • 178 rooms in property
From$31
Very Good 4.0 /5 Read Reviews Call BookMore Details
Malibu Resort Motel
+1-888-965-8297
17001 Gulf Blvd., North Redington Beach, FL 33708 ~6.98 miles northwest of 33736
  • Cheap Beach hotel
  • 2 suites in hotel
From$70
Average 3.5 /5 Latest Reviews Call BookMore Details
Avalon Hotel Downtown St. Petersburg : 443 4th Ave. North
+1-888-906-6358
443 4th Ave. North, St Petersburg, FL 33701 ~7.04 miles east of 33736
  • Mid-scale property
From$99
Very Good 4.0 /5 Read Reviews Call BookMore Details
Courtyard by Marriott St. Petersburg Downtown - St. Petersburg
+1-888-749-6785
300 4th St. North, St. Petersburg, FL 33701 ~7.06 miles east of 33736
  • Mid-scale Downtown property
  • Access to gym on-site
From$139
Very Good 4.0 /5 Latest Reviews Call BookMore Details
Hollander Boutique Hotel : 421 4th Ave. North
+1-888-878-9982
421 4th Ave. North, St Petersburg, FL 33701 ~7.07 miles east of 33736
  • 3 star property
  • Hotel has 3 floors
From$105
Very Good 4.0 /5 Recent Reviews Call BookMore Details

Next: Show All Available 33736 Hotels with Pricing

Graph: Upcoming 20 Days of 33736 Hotel Rates

Rates shown are nightly rates before taxes and do not necessarily reflect all St. Pete Beach, FL discounts available. The chart reflects the cheapest St. Pete Beach hotel for each day and each star rating category.

FAQs about hotels near 33736

What are the most favored hotels near 33736?

Provident Oceana Beachfront, Cambria Hotel St. Petersburg Madeira Beach and Crystal Palms Beach Resort are the best rated hotels based on customer reviews in the last 365 days.

What are the most luxurious hotels near 33736?

RumFish Beach Resort by TradeWinds, Island Grand a Tradewinds Beach Resort and Dolphin Beach Resort are the top 3 luxury hotels near 33736.

What hotels are closest to the area of 33736?

Blind Pass Resort Motel, Postcard Inn on the Beach, and Hilton Garden Inn St. Pete Beach are the properties closest to 33736.

How much does a cheap hotel near 33736 cost per night?

In the last year, a 2 star hotel near 33736 can be as cheap as $134.22 per night. (based on HotelPlanner prices)

How much does a 3 star hotel near 33736 cost per night?

In the last year, the average 3 star hotel near 33736 has been $204.03 per night. (based on HotelPlanner prices)

How much does a higher-end hotel near 33736 cost?

In the last year, the average 4 star hotel near 33736 has been $252.62 per night. (based on HotelPlanner prices)

What are the best independent hotels near 33736?

Provident Oceana Beachfront, Crystal Palms Beach Resort and Blind Pass Resort Motel are the best rated independent hotels (not part of a big brand).

What are the most popular Marriott hotels near 33736?

Courtyard by Marriott St. Petersburg Clearwater, Courtyard by Marriott St. Petersburg Downtown and Residence Inn St Petersburg Treasure Island are the best rated Marriott/Starwood branded hotels (based on customer reviews score).

What are the most popular Choice Hotels branded hotels near 33736?

Cambria Hotel St. Petersburg Madeira Beach and Quality Inn & Suites at Tropicana Field are the best rated Choice Hotels branded hotels (based on HotelPlanner reviews score).

What are the most popular IHG hotels near 33736?

Holiday Inn Express & Suites St. Petersburg Madeira Beach, Staybridge Suites St. Petersburg Downtown and Holiday Inn St. Petersburg West are the best rated Intercontinental Hotel Group (IHG) branded hotels (based on user reviews score).

Back to Top